I have known about the CMP program for years, but I never took advantage of it. I was at the Houston gun show in January, and was surprised to see you (CMP) there with tables and tables of rifles. I was even more 
surprised that you could pick out a particular rifle and "reserve" it. This has to be the best new practice that you have started. I watched the crowd feverishly inspect, ask questions, and pick out rifle after rifle. One gentleman loitered near and waited patiently for hours as rifles were reserved and put away, and then more rifles were brought out. He told me he wasn't going to pass this opportunity up to "reserve" them as it may never happen again. He ended up picking out all 8 of his rifles for the year. I ended up reserving a Greek Service Grade and promptly sent in my paperwork. It showed up about 30 days later. I am very pleased with it. I had previously been reluctant due to the fact that it normally is a "luck of the draw". I can only say one thing. I hope that you continue to visit the gun shows around the country and offer this unique opportunity to others. My only concern is that you make it back to Houston, and that if you do, there are still plenty for me. Thanks. Jarrod B.

CMP, I just wanted to relay the following story: I recently was able to sight in my recently purchased M1 and 1903 Springfield. After firing rounds at all ranges between 100-300 yds with both rifles, I was almost out of ammunition and I wanted to see if the "battle sight" on the '03 really was set for the 547 yds that the WWI Infantry Drill Regulation manual claimed, and try my luck with the 500 yard target/gong. I had my 9 yr old son on the next bench over with field glasses spotting for me and fired my first round.  We both missed the impact. I fired a second round and we both saw the impact below the target in the dust. I adjusted my sight picture and my next 3 rds all "dinged the gong." To say that I was pleasantly surprised by the rifle's performance with iron sights and the Lake City 30.06 Match ammo would be an understatement. Both rifles are outstanding. Thanks again, Bob W. Bellevue, NE.
